Aurora, WV vs Bath (Berkeley Springs), WV
The cost of living difference between Aurora, WV and Bath (Berkeley Springs), WV is dramatic. Bath (Berkeley Springs) is 31.9% cheaper than Aurora,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Aurora has a cost index of 97 while Bath (Berkeley Springs) sits at 74,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
Median household income in Aurora is $55,296 compared to $36,250 in Bath (Berkeley Springs) (+52.5%). While Aurora is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
Climate-wise, Bath (Berkeley Springs) is notably warmer with an average of 54.1°F compared to 46.5°F in Aurora. Aurora receives more rainfall at 56.7" per year compared to 39" in Bath (Berkeley Springs).
